What is a Line Production Company?
A line production company specialises in managing the on-ground execution of a film or video project. Think of them as the operational backbone of a production.
It is easy to confuse a line producer with a line production company. A line producer is typically an individual responsible for budgeting and day-to-day management. A line production company, however, is an entire team that provides end-to-end services which include logistics, crew, equipment, permits, and much more.
One common misconception is that line production is only about hiring crew or renting equipment. In reality, their work goes far beyond that. They are responsible for planning, coordinating, and troubleshooting every moving part of a shoot so the creative team can focus on storytelling.
Key Roles & Responsibilities
A line production services takes on a wide range of responsibilities. Here are some of the most important ones:
Budgeting & Cost Control
The first step in any project is breaking down the script into costs. A line production company creates detailed budgets that cover crew salaries, equipment rentals, locations, transport, food, and other expenses. They also monitor spending throughout the shoot to ensure the project does not go over budget.
Location Scouting & Permits
Finding the right location is often a challenge in filmmaking. Line production companies not only scout ideal spots but also handle permits, permissions, and clearances from local authorities. This is crucial for avoiding costly last-minute setbacks.
Crew & Casting Support
Whether it is hiring camera operators, lighting technicians, makeup artists, or local extras, line production companies build the right team for the project. Their network of trusted professionals helps ensure reliable support on set.
Equipment & Logistics
From cameras and lenses to lighting rigs, sound equipment, and props, sourcing gear is a major responsibility. Line production companies coordinate with rental houses and make sure everything is delivered, set up, and functional on time.
On-Set Coordination
Daily scheduling, creating call sheets, managing transportation, and ensuring that every department is aligned all fall under their supervision. They are the glue that holds the production together during shooting days.
Compliance & Insurance
Shooting often involves legal and safety considerations. Line production companies make sure productions follow labour laws, union rules, and insurance requirements. They also handle risk assessments to safeguard both cast and crew.

Services Offered by a Line Production Company
Line production companies adapt their services to the type of project. Common offerings include:
· Feature Films: Managing large-scale shoots with big crews, multiple locations, and complex budgets.
· TV Commercials & Branded Content: Fast turnarounds with high-quality output.
· Music Videos: Coordinating creative, often unconventional shoots that need special sets or locations.
· Documentaries: Handling travel, research support, and access to unique locations.
· OTT & Web Series Projects: Managing tight deadlines and episodic structures.
· International Productions in India: Acting as fixers for foreign teams, offering end-to-end support with locations, permits, and local crew.
This flexibility makes line production companies valuable partners across industries, from Bollywood blockbusters to small indie films and global ad campaigns.
